holyya.com
2025-09-05 02:23:42 Friday
登录
文章检索 我的文章 写文章
Java经典问题解决方案
2023-06-14 20:38:03 深夜i     --     --

Java作为一门流行的编程语言,在开发中经常会遇到各种问题,其中一些问题属于经典问题。在本篇文章中,我们将探讨这些经典问题,并提供相应的解决方案,帮助读者解决类似问题。

1. 内存泄漏

内存泄漏是Java开发中最经典的问题之一,它指的是一个对象在不再使用时仍然占用着内存,从而导致系统的内存不足。解决内存泄漏的方法有很多,包括代码审查、使用垃圾回收和避免创建过多的对象等。

2. 并发问题

随着计算机技术的发展,多线程已经成为Java程序中非常常见的一部分。但是,多线程也会引发并发问题,例如死锁、竞态条件、线程饥饿等。为了解决这些问题,开发者需要掌握多线程编程的基本原理,并采取一些常见的并发控制机制,例如锁、信号量和线程池。

3. 性能问题

性能问题是Java开发中另一个非常重要的经典问题。在Java开发中,性能问题通常表现为内存使用过多、响应时间过长、CPU占用过高等。解决性能问题需要从多个方面入手,例如调整JVM参数、优化算法、减少网络通信等。

总结:

Java作为一门流行的编程语言,面对着各种问题。但只有学会解决这些经典问题,才能更好地应对开发中的挑战。内存泄漏,并发问题和性能问题或许是最常见的,但遇到更多问题时,我们也应该以相似的思想来应对。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复